Concrete mudjacking services involve the process of lifting and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a specialized mixture beneath them. This mixture, often a slurry of cement, sand, and water, is pumped into hollowed-out or voided areas beneath the concrete slab. Once injected, the material fills the gaps, providing support and raising the surface back to its intended level. The procedure is typically performed using specialized equipment that ensures precise placement, resulting in a smoother, more stable surface without the need for complete replacement.
This service is especially effective in addressing problems caused by soil settlement, erosion, or poor initial installation. Over time, concrete slabs such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ors can sink or become uneven, creating tripping hazards and aesthetic issues. Mudjacking restores the original height and surface integrity of these concrete elements, helping to eliminate hazards and improve the overall appearance of the property. It also helps prevent further damage by stabilizing the underlying soil and reducing the risk of additional settling.

Cost Range - Concrete mudjacking services typically cost between $500 and $1,500 per slab. The exact price depends on the size and extent of the repair needed, with larger projects tending to be more expensive.
Factors Influencing Cost - Factors such as the depth of the settling, access difficulty, and local labor rates can affect the overall cost. For example, a small sidewalk section may be closer to $500, while a large driveway could reach $2,000 or more.
Average Pricing - On average, homeowners in Overland Park, KS, might expect to pay around $800 to $1,200 for typical mudjacking work. Prices can vary based on specific project requirements and contractor rates in the area.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include surface preparation or repairs to surrounding areas, which can add a few hundred dollars to the total. It’s recommended to cont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to individual proj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
